This Mechanical Technician position will give you the genuine opportunity to develop your career within a fantastic organisation who look after their people. Based in north Cambridge, this global company work within the semiconductor industry and manufacture some of the most high-tech systems in that market.

Working within their Production team, you will be supporting the mechanical installation and build of assemblies, including some quite complex sub-assemblies. You will need to be a skilled Technician who can read engineering drawings.

This is a standard day shift role, but you may be required to be flexible from time to time as the workload demands.

The Role:

  • Component / specialist sub-assembly manufacture
  • Working to detailed engineering drawings
  • Use of basic machine shop equipment
  • Fabrication and orbital / manual welding (training available)
  • Liaise closely with the Production Supervisor and the engineering team to ensure that products are completed on time and built to the technical brief
  • Possibly some occasional national and international travel

About You:

  • Good mechanical assembly and testing background, preferably with a technical qualification
  • Excellent practical and technical skills
  • Understanding of engineering drawings and principles
  • IT literate with accurate data recording ability
  • Vacuum leak testing experience would be very helpful
  • Orbital / hand tig welding experience would be a bonus
